In-Depth Look at the Itinerary and Experience
Pickup and Transportation
Your evening begins at your hotel in Lisbon around 8 pm, where your driver—dressed in a smart suit—greets you warmly. The ride to Sintra takes approximately 30 minutes, during which you can settle into your elegant Jaguar with air conditioning and complimentary mineral water or light refreshments. The vehicle itself is part of the charm—think of it as an experience within an experience, a throwback to British royalty’s choice of transport (as the late Queen Elizabeth II once drove a similar model).

Considerations and Limitations
This tour involves about 2 hours of walking, which requires a reasonable level of mobility. If you’re unsteady on your feet or have mobility issues, it’s worth considering. The tour also runs from 8 pm to around 11 pm, so packing a jacket is advisable, especially during cooler months or foggy nights.
It’s important to note that entry tickets to attractions are not included, so if you wish to visit Pena Palace or other landmarks during your visit (not part of the guided walk), you’ll need to purchase those separately.

FAQ
Is this tour suitable for children under 12?
No, it’s not recommended for children under 12, primarily because of the walking involved and the adult-oriented experience.
Can I cancel this tour?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ering some flexibility if your plans change.
What is included in the price?
The price covers hotel pick-up and drop-off, a private tour in an elegant Jaguar with air conditioning, a local native driver/guide, mineral bottled water, and passenger insurance.
Are entry tickets to attractions included?
No, entry to specific landmarks like Pena Palace is not included, so you’ll need to purchase those separately if you wish to visit during your time in Sintra.
What should I bring?
A jacket is recommended due to cooler evening temperatures and possible foggy weather, especially in late months.
Is this tour wheelchair accessible?
No, it’s not suitable for wheelchair users, given the walking involved and possibly uneven streets.
What languages are available for the guide?
The tour is conducted in English, Portuguese, and Spanish, accommodating various travelers.
How long is the entire experience?
The tour lasts approximately 4 hours, starting at 8 pm and returning around 11 pm.
Can I reserve and pay later?
Yes, you can reserve now without paying immediately to keep your plans flexible.
